DECR chairman visits the Paraguayan Catholic University
On July 1, 2011, during his visit to Paraguay, Metropolitan Hilarion, head of the Moscow Patriarchate’s department for external church relations, visited the Catholic University of Asuncion, one of the leading educational institutions in Paraguay.
Metropolitan Hilarion delivered a lecture at the university’s assembly hall to students and professors. Present were also representatives of the university administration and the Catholic Archdiocese of Asuncion, as well as Russian expatriates.
Speaking about the role of Russian emigrants in the development of Paraguay as an independent country, Metropolitan Hilarion said in particular, ‘I have covered over 13 thousand kilometres to come to Paraguay to congratulate its leaders and public on the 200th anniversary of independence. We all highly appreciate the fact that people in Paraguay cherish the memory of Russian warriors who helped the Paraguayans to defend their national interests in the bloody Chaco War in the 1930s’.
Metropolitan Hilarion also spoke about the life of the Russian Orthodox Church today, her international activities and the revival of monastic life and religious education in Russia and other countries under the canonical jurisdiction of the Moscow Patriarchate.
After the lecture Metropolitan Hilarion answered numerous questions from the audience. As a token of his visit, he presented the Catholic University of Asuncion with an icon of the Most Holy Mother of God.
